Como converter JPM para PPTX usando GroupDocs.Conversion para .NET: um guia passo a passo
Introdução
Com dificuldades para converter arquivos de imagem JPEG 2000 (.jpm) em apresentações do PowerPoint Open XML (.pptx)? Este guia completo o orientará no uso da biblioteca GroupDocs.Conversion para .NET para realizar essa conversão sem problemas.
O que você aprenderá:
- Configurando seu ambiente para GroupDocs.Conversion para .NET
- Instruções passo a passo sobre como converter JPM para PPTX
- Aplicações do mundo real e possibilidades de integração
- Técnicas de otimização de desempenho
Vamos começar garantindo que você tenha os pré-requisitos necessários.
Pré-requisitos
Certifique-se de que sua configuração atenda a estes requisitos antes de começar a implementação:
Bibliotecas e versões necessárias:
- GroupDocs.Conversion para .NET (Versão 25.3.0)
Requisitos de configuração do ambiente:
- Um ambiente de desenvolvimento que suporta o framework .NET
- Visual Studio ou um IDE similar
Pré-requisitos de conhecimento:
- Compreensão básica da programação C#
- Familiaridade com estruturas de projetos .NET e gerenciamento de pacotes
Configurando GroupDocs.Conversion para .NET
Para começar a usar o GroupDocs.Conversion em seus projetos .NET, siga estas etapas de instalação:
Console do gerenciador de pacotes NuGet
Execute o seguinte comando para instalar o GroupDocs.Conversion:
dotnet add package GroupDocs.Conversion --version 25.3.0
Etapas de aquisição de licença
- Teste gratuito: Baixe uma versão de teste em Testes gratuitos do GroupDocs.
- Licença temporária: Obtenha uma licença temporária para testes prolongados por meio de Página de Licença Temporária.
- Comprar: Considere adquirir uma licença completa se estiver satisfeito com os resultados Compra do GroupDocs.
Após a instalação, inicialize o GroupDocs.Conversion no seu projeto C#:
using GroupDocs.Conversion;
// Inicializar conversor
var converter = new Converter("sample.jpm");
Guia de Implementação
Convertendo JPM para PPTX
Vamos dividir o processo de conversão em etapas gerenciáveis.
Etapa 1: Carregue o arquivo de entrada
Comece carregando seu arquivo JPM usando o Converter
classe, que especifica a origem dos dados da sua imagem.
using (var converter = new Converter("sample.jpm"))
{
// A lógica de conversão será inserida aqui.
}
Explicação: O Converter
A classe manipula o arquivo de entrada, preparando-o para conversão para vários formatos, incluindo PPTX.
Etapa 2: Configurar opções de conversão
Defina o formato de destino e quaisquer configurações específicas usando PresentationConvertOptions
.
var options = new PresentationConvertOptions();
options.Format = GroupDocs.Conversion.FileTypes.PresentationFileType.Pptx;
Explicação: O PresentationConvertOptions
A classe permite que você configure propriedades como tipo de arquivo, tamanho do slide e muito mais.
Etapa 3: Execute a conversão
Realize a conversão chamando o Convert
método com suas opções.
csvconverter.Convert("output.pptx", options);
Explicação: Este método processa os dados JPM em um arquivo PPTX, gravando-os no local de saída especificado.
Dicas para solução de problemas
- Erro de arquivo não encontrado: Certifique-se de que o caminho de entrada esteja correto e acessível.
- Problemas de permissão: Verifique se seu aplicativo tem permissões de gravação para o diretório de saída.
Aplicações práticas
A integração dessa capacidade de conversão pode ser benéfica em vários cenários:
- Campanhas de Marketing Digital: Converta imagens de alta qualidade em apresentações para propostas de clientes ou argumentos de marketing.
- Setor de Educação: Transforme conjuntos de dados de imagens em apresentações de slides interativas para fins de ensino.
- Apresentações Corporativas: Integre perfeitamente conteúdo visual de vários formatos em relatórios da empresa.
Considerações de desempenho
Ao lidar com conversões de arquivos, considere estas dicas de otimização:
- Diretrizes de uso de recursos: Monitore o uso da memória e da CPU para evitar gargalos durante o processamento em lote.
- Melhores práticas para gerenciamento de memória .NET: Descarte os objetos de forma adequada usando
using
declarações ou métodos explícitos de descarte para liberar recursos de forma eficiente.
Conclusão
Neste tutorial, você aprendeu a converter arquivos JPM para o formato PPTX usando o GroupDocs.Conversion para .NET. Esta ferramenta poderosa simplifica as tarefas de conversão de arquivos e se integra perfeitamente aos seus projetos .NET. Como próximo passo, experimente diferentes configurações e explore recursos adicionais na biblioteca do GroupDocs.
Chamada para ação: Implemente esta solução hoje mesmo para ter conversões otimizadas!
Seção de perguntas frequentes
- Posso converter vários arquivos JPM de uma só vez?
- Sim, você pode percorrer uma série de caminhos de arquivo para processar conversões em lote.
- E se minha versão do .NET não for compatível com o GroupDocs.Conversion?
- Certifique-se de que seu projeto tenha como alvo uma versão de framework suportada, conforme especificado na documentação.
- Como lidar com erros de conversão com elegância?
- Implemente blocos try-catch em torno da lógica de conversão para gerenciar exceções de forma eficaz.
- Existem limitações de tamanho de arquivo para arquivos JPM?
- Embora o GroupDocs.Conversion manipule arquivos grandes, sempre considere a capacidade dos recursos do seu sistema.
- Onde posso encontrar opções de configuração mais avançadas?
- Visite o Referência de API para explorar configurações e métodos adicionais.
Recursos
- Documentação: Conversão de GroupDocs .NET Docs
- Referência da API: Detalhes da API
- Download: Obtenha a Biblioteca
- Licença de compra: Comprar GroupDocs
- Teste gratuito: Baixe a versão gratuita
- Licença temporária: Solicitar licença temporária
- Fórum de suporte: Comunidade GroupDocs